Leicester City are set to make Ghana international Abdul Fatawu Issahaku’s move a permanent one.


This comes after the English club decided to trigger his €17 million buy option having spent the 2023/24 season on loan at the club from Portugal’s Sporting Lisbon.


The 20-year-old attacker played an integral role in the Foxes’ quick return to the English Premier League as they won the English Championship.


“We will make money,” Sporting Lisbon manager Ruben Amorim said according to Italian sports journalist Fabrizio Romano.


“Talented players who don’t adapt here will move to other clubs and give us added value, it’s our system.”


Issahaku has netted seven goals and provided 13 assists for Leicester and he has been named the club’s Best Young Player.


He is expected to be part of the Ghana squad that will face Mali and Central African Republic in the 2026 FIFA World Cup qualifiers in June 2024.
